    Description

    Mongoose Publishing's Victory at Sea WWII naval combat game (Victory at Sea original design by Matthew Sprange) is expanded in this 120+ page supplement. New rules and fleet lists increase historical accuracy and give players new options for historical and "build your own" fleets. Contents include:

    • New Rules (shore batteries, night battles, terrain, kamikazes, minefields)
    • Motor Torpedo Boats
    • Admirals
    • Advanced Air Operations
    • Scenarios
    • Operational Campaign Rules
    • Expanded Fleet Lists
    • The Royal Navy
    • The Kriegsmarine
    • The United States Navy
    • The Imperial Japanese Navy
    • The Italian Navy
    • The French Navy
    • The Soviet Navy
    • Civilian Shipping
